Top 5 Tennis Games in the US: Q4 2025 Performance Review
Explore the Q4 2025 performance trends of the top 5 tennis game apps in the US, featuring download, revenue, and active user insights from Sensor Tower.
The fourth quarter of 2025 saw intriguing performance trends among the top tennis games on a unified platform in the United States. Here's a closer look at how these apps fared in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users.
Tennis Clash:Sports Stars Game from Wildlife Studios experienced a decline in weekly revenue, starting at about $129K and reducing to around $80K by the end of December. Downloads saw a dip initially but rebounded to 14.7K in the last week. Active users fluctuated, with a notable dip mid-quarter, ending at around 101K.
Retro Slam Tennis by New Star Games maintained modest weekly revenues, peaking at $621 in late October. Downloads remained steady, averaging around 3K weekly, with a slight increase towards the end of December.
Tennis Arena from Helium9 Games saw varied revenue, peaking at $4.3K initially, with a dip mid-quarter and a recovery to $3.7K by year-end. Downloads showed a slight increase to 2.5K in the final week, while active users hovered around 5K, ending the quarter with a slight uptick.
Tennis World Open 2025 - Sport by Inlogic Software experienced low revenue throughout, peaking at $154 in early October. Downloads remained consistent, with a slight increase to 1.1K by December’s end. Active users saw a gradual decline, ending the quarter at approximately 3.8K.
Twin Tennis from Voodoo showed a low but variable revenue pattern, with notable peaks in late October and December. Downloads surged mid-quarter, peaking at 1.8K in early December. Active users remained relatively stable throughout, closing the quarter at around 41K.
